Understanding Magnetic Door Locks: A Comprehensive Guide
Magnetic door locks, also referred to as electro-magnetic locks, have gotten significant attention in the world of security services. They use the basic principles of electromagnetism to secure doors and gain access to points. This article seeks to provide an extensive understanding of magnetic door locks, their performance, advantages, difficulties, and typical applications.
What Are Magnetic Door Locks?
Magnetic door locks include 2 main elements: an electro-magnetic lock (often described as a mag-lock) and a matching armature plate. The electro-magnetic lock is set up on the door frame, while the armature plate is mounted on the door itself. When the lock is energized, an electromagnetic field is produced, causing the armature plate to be drawn in to the lock. This leads to a secure bond that prevents the door from being opened.
Parts of a Magnetic Door Lock System
| Element | Description |
|---|---|
| Electromagnetic Lock | The main locking mechanism that produces an electromagnetic field |
| Armature Plate | A piece of ferromagnetic product that reacts to the magnetic field |
| Power Supply | Supplies electrical power to the electromagnetic lock |
| Control System | Can include access control devices (keypads, card readers) |
How Do Magnetic Door Locks Work?
The operation of a magnetic replacement door locks lock depends upon 2 crucial concepts: electricity and magnetism. When the electrical present circulations through the electro-magnetic coil within the lock, it generates a magnetic field. This field draws in the armature plate, resulting in a tight hold. Alternatively, when the power supply is interrupted, the magnetic force vanishes, enabling the door to open.

Benefits of Magnetic Door Locks
Magnetic door locks provide a number of benefits that make them a popular option for security:
- High Security: With a holding force that can surpass 1,500 pounds, magnetic locks offer robust security versus unauthorized access.
- Toughness: Constructed from top quality materials, these locks are resistant to vandalism and climate condition.
- Easy Installation: Magnetic locks can be set up on numerous types of doors, and installation is typically easier than standard locking mechanisms.
- Automatic Locking: Many systems can be set up to engage immediately when the door closes, making sure constant security.
- Push-button Control Options: With combination into digital management systems, they can be managed remotely, enabling ease of usage and enhanced security dynamics.
Common Applications of Magnetic Door Locks
Magnetic door locks are utilized throughout many sectors due to their versatility and security functions. Some typical applications consist of:
- commercial door locks Buildings: Used to secure workplaces and limited gain access to locations.
- Educational Institutions: Employed to control access to sensitive locations like labs.
- Healthcare Facilities: Utilized to protect client records and drug storage areas.
- Public Transport Facilities: Used in train stations and airports for ticket control and secure entry points.
Challenges and Considerations
While magnetic door locks have numerous advantages, they likewise come with specific obstacles that must be attended to:
- Power Dependency: Magnetic locks are totally dependent on electricity. In the occasion of a power outage, the locks might not operate unless they are battery-backed.
- Potential False Alarms: If not effectively installed or calibrated, magnetic doors can be vulnerable to false alarms.
- Minimal Resilience Against Physical Force: While they provide a strong holding force, they can be prone to physical attacks if used with the right tools.
FAQs About Magnetic Door Locks
1. Are magnetic back door locks locks appropriate for all kinds of doors?
Yes, magnetic door locks can be set up on the majority of types of doors, consisting of wood and metal doors, as long as the installation standards are followed.
2. Can magnetic door locks be used outside?
While magnetic locks can be utilized outdoors, it's important to guarantee that the selected lock is designed for exterior usage to stand up to weather.
3. Just how much power do magnetic door locks take in?
The power usage can vary based upon the particular design, however most magnetic locks only draw power when engaged, usually consuming around 500 to 600 milliamps.
4. Can I set up a magnetic door lock myself?
While some DIY enthusiasts might attempt to install these locks, it is recommended to employ an expert for optimum performance and security assurance.
5. What takes place if the power goes out?
If the magnetic lock is not equipped with a battery backup, the door will open when power is lost, providing a possible security danger.
